Commit Graph

1124 Commits

Author SHA1 Message Date
qctecmdr
d82b7ce8c2 Merge "ARM: dts: msm: pmih010x: make hap_swr_slave always on" 2024-01-16 06:45:06 -08:00
qctecmdr
d15d5b36a0 Merge "ARM: dts: msm: Remove fastrpc glink node" 2024-01-16 01:36:23 -08:00
Peng Yang
aead4f0856 ARM: dts: qcom: Update board-id for Sun vms QRD
Update board-id for Sun TUIVM and OEMVM.

Change-Id: I3a749a10825c41e3d53ddfe048e92e8fb09df235
Signed-off-by: Peng Yang <quic_penyan@quicinc.com>
2024-01-16 17:30:23 +08:00
Manaf Meethalavalappu Pallikunhi
bc9d576e84 ARM: dts: qcom: update tsens thermal zone trips for sun
Target like sun supports max Tj for tsens up to 130C.
Update all tsens userspace and reset monitor trips
accordingly.

Change-Id: I2f59742686c1b9c1c976c4a1fc668f3e53454686
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-16 01:08:49 -08:00
congying
96d502e48a ARM: dts: qcom: update thermistor thermal zone name for sun
Update thermistor thermal zone name for sun based on
latest thermistor tables.

Assigning xo-therm to SYS-THERM-0 for qlm.

Change-Id: I5ae8580fa91d1cad1b0666872c634a1c48113c91
Signed-off-by: congying <quic_congying@quicinc.com>
2024-01-16 15:57:11 +08:00
Meena Pasumarthi
2e885def36 ARM: dts: qcom: Support for Sun vms MTP-V8 and RCM
Add initial Sun VMs MTP-V8 and RCM device tree support.

Change-Id: I9650efe5baca5d72a3c991f93119cdf00b52a3dd
Signed-off-by: Meena Pasumarthi <quic_pasumart@quicinc.com>
2024-01-16 12:29:28 +05:30
qctecmdr
7f27f34484 Merge "ARM: dts: msm: Add support for Sun SoC + Kiwi on RCM platform" 2024-01-15 11:08:11 -08:00
qctecmdr
f44f619528 Merge "dt-bindings: Add QDSS clock node for LLCC Perfmon" 2024-01-14 20:48:04 -08:00
Unnathi Chalicheemala
7de3976704 ARM: dts: msm: Add support for Sun SoC + Kiwi on RCM platform
Add device tree files needed to support Sun SoC + Kiwi on RCM
platform.

Change-Id: I0752eb6d3a4a855c9619cc4fcd3587385eae21e3
Signed-off-by: Unnathi Chalicheemala <quic_uchalich@quicinc.com>
2024-01-14 19:32:56 -08:00
Unnathi Chalicheemala
9d008c8ed3 ARM: dts: msm: Add v8 power grid support for RCM on Sun SoC
Add device tree files to support v8 power grid for RCM platform
on Sun SoC.

Change-Id: I19c83c895858cee34be569041b04931a76d551e1
Signed-off-by: Unnathi Chalicheemala <quic_uchalich@quicinc.com>
2024-01-14 19:32:10 -08:00
Daniel Perez-Zoghbi
e495a11e0a ARM: dts: qcom: Use non-coherent on QCE CB
Switch to using dma-noncoherent context bank on qce. Dma-coherent was
causing stale data to be read. SS confirmed that this was fixed by using
dma-noncoherent. Using explicit dma-noncoherent because the parent node,
qcedev, is dma-coherent, and the context bank would inherit it.

Change-Id: Ic6f45b15a9eb29bc7317fd824318cb219a29e0c2
Signed-off-by: Daniel Perez-Zoghbi <quic_dperezzo@quicinc.com>
2024-01-12 16:33:37 -08:00
qctecmdr
1e23632dc1 Merge "ARM: dts: qcom: Enable modem mitigation for modem Tj for sun" 2024-01-12 15:10:01 -08:00
Anjelique Melendez
c2fd38affe ARM: dts: qcom: Add PPG support for PM8550 led-controller
Add the nvmem and nvmem-name properties to the LED LPG led-controller
device to enable PPG in PM8550.

Change-Id: I118676c61b098d63d18f6772291db444157b73a8
Signed-off-by: Anjelique Melendez <quic_amelende@quicinc.com>
2024-01-12 14:12:42 -08:00
Manaf Meethalavalappu Pallikunhi
f435702c3b ARM: dts: qcom: Enable modem mitigation for modem Tj for sun
Enable modem dsc fail safe mitigation for modem TSENS thermal zones
for sun.

Change-Id: I4e8af8f0cb7d1bcf26d25572319e1cf87ba92fce
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-13 01:35:18 +05:30
Unnathi Chalicheemala
f612c33c32 ARM: dts: msm: Add System Health Monitor DT node for Sun
Add System Health Monitor node with MPSS subsystem support for
Sun SoC.

Change-Id: Ie6fd1cf0e765bd6ef55c230d68066bf8a3115f75
Signed-off-by: Unnathi Chalicheemala <quic_uchalich@quicinc.com>
2024-01-11 17:29:10 -08:00
quic_anane
a454481d80 ARM: dts: msm: Remove fastrpc glink node
FastRPC node is added under glink node to provide intent
information. With fastrpc driver migrating to upstream
driver, this property will be overlayed from out of
kernel. Also update glink label for adsp and cdsp.

Change-Id: Ia7463d32369e02637abe4bfab5c18cf2bc8d5b03
Signed-off-by: quic_anane <quic_anane@quicinc.com>
2024-01-11 17:47:42 +05:30
Udit Tiwari
06ad45f10b ARM: dts: qcom: Add TRNG node for Sun
The Sun SoC has a True Random Number Generator, add the node with
the correct compatible set.

Change-Id: I67837f8e674be6445e35b4b1512b890f43861e4f
Signed-off-by: Udit Tiwari <quic_utiwari@quicinc.com>
2024-01-11 14:25:20 +05:30
qctecmdr
a726097db3 Merge "ARM: dts: msm: increase dmesg buffer size to 512K from 256K" 2024-01-10 20:27:16 -08:00
Amirreza Zarrabi
b45da59563 ARM: dts: msm: enable memory object extension for si-core
Add DT entry to enable the memory onject support for
smcinvoke.

Change-Id: I87b62b048e94e2aad2a8329b275bbd8d75ae6cc7
Signed-off-by: Amirreza Zarrabi <quic_azarrabi@quicinc.com>
2024-01-10 17:42:57 -08:00
qctecmdr
fa05532d84 Merge "ARM: dts: qcom: enable userspace cooling device for display fps" 2024-01-10 15:29:10 -08:00
Satya Durga Srinivasu Prabhala
a238a42a5f ARM: dts: msm: increase dmesg buffer size to 512K from 256K
As soon as device boots up, there are few test cases like boot KPIs
which rely on dmesg, but by the time these tests are run on Sun,
buffer is getting overwritten and test cases were failing.
To unblock the tests, increase buffer size to 512K from 256K.

Change-Id: Ie6a810297553d1a104d00f87dae3bff51dac7b95
Signed-off-by: Satya Durga Srinivasu Prabhala <quic_satyap@quicinc.com>
2024-01-10 13:54:22 -08:00
qctecmdr
3267f619d0 Merge "ARM: dts: qcom: update thermal cpu pause and hotplug cooling devices" 2024-01-10 13:29:18 -08:00
qctecmdr
152064be81 Merge "ARM: dts: qcom: Enable DDR cooling device for sun" 2024-01-10 11:18:47 -08:00
qctecmdr
acbf488352 Merge "ARM: dts: msm: Add icc display CRM voters for Sun" 2024-01-10 11:18:46 -08:00
qctecmdr
8b3cdf4776 Merge "ARM: dts: msm: add cluster cache dump entry on sun" 2024-01-10 05:52:59 -08:00
qctecmdr
8c5fe1b195 Merge "ARM: dts: msm: Add v8 power grid with Kiwi DT support for RCM" 2024-01-10 02:33:34 -08:00
Bao D. Nguyen
3e6532aa19 ARM: dts: qcom: Enable UFS MCQ on Sun platforms
Enable the UFS MCQ feature on the Sun platforms.

Change-Id: I86016f54c57825fe4c5c51682e619bedafe4786b
Signed-off-by: Bao D. Nguyen <quic_nguyenb@quicinc.com>
2024-01-09 19:24:53 -08:00
qctecmdr
a480ab116f Merge "ARM: dts: msm: Add idx table to llcc pmu for sun" 2024-01-09 18:31:08 -08:00
qctecmdr
ce2c29ee84 Merge "ARM: dts: qcom: Enable userspace CPU freq cooling device for sun" 2024-01-09 16:21:27 -08:00
qctecmdr
16ca468843 Merge "ARM: dts: msm: Add LLCC broadacst register mappings" 2024-01-09 14:05:30 -08:00
qctecmdr
358e6f0818 Merge "ARM: dts: msm: Update NFC supported platforms on Sun SoC" 2024-01-09 14:05:30 -08:00
Unnathi Chalicheemala
095a1bb1e5 ARM: dts: msm: Add v8 power grid with Kiwi DT support for RCM
Add device tree support for v8 power grid with Kiwi on RCM
platform for Sun SoC.

Change-Id: I3fd53532099978b54dd13957e977115e1714819d
Signed-off-by: Unnathi Chalicheemala <quic_uchalich@quicinc.com>
2024-01-09 13:31:12 -08:00
Fenglin Wu
dc4c61bc05 ARM: dts: msm: pmih010x: make hap_swr_slave always on
Hap_swr_slave regulator device controls register which takes SWR slave
out of reset, it's being reused to reset VI_sense block in pmih010x
haptics. SWR needs to be kept enabled to keep VI_sense enabled.
Hence, make hap_swr_slave regulator device always on.

Change-Id: Idf9f09b972b18cb836f643b85a1a587ab5af8f32
Signed-off-by: Fenglin Wu <quic_fenglinw@quicinc.com>
2024-01-09 17:54:05 +08:00
qctecmdr
a136644099 Merge "ARM: dts: msm: add gpu funnel for sun" 2024-01-08 20:59:23 -08:00
qctecmdr
22cca13b7b Merge "ARM: dts: qcom: keep L2F and L3F regulators always-on for Sun boards" 2024-01-08 20:59:23 -08:00
qctecmdr
92b71019cf Merge "ARM: dts: qcom: add SSR and PDR support for PMIC Glink on Sun" 2024-01-08 18:37:56 -08:00
Subbaraman Narayanamurthy
0e26fb17fa ARM: dts: qcom: add pmd802x amoled device for Sun
Add pmd802x amoled device and regulator devices ab, ibb and oled
under it along with the nvmem configuration needed to support the
IBB spur mitigation feature. This may be used by some customers.

Change-Id: I174ed6270da56bea7bb256af4f72b91bb059779d
Signed-off-by: Subbaraman Narayanamurthy <quic_subbaram@quicinc.com>
2024-01-08 16:21:05 -08:00
Unnathi Chalicheemala
6519f74339 ARM: dts: msm: Update NFC supported platforms on Sun SoC
NFC on Sun SoC only supports v8 but is defaulting to v6 power grid.
Update NFC on Sun SoC to use v8 power grid now for MTP, CDP platforms.

Change-Id: I0c5c93adf1b6c9dfa5fd05b975e4d184995e60e5
Signed-off-by: Unnathi Chalicheemala <quic_uchalich@quicinc.com>
2024-01-08 14:54:57 -08:00
Manaf Meethalavalappu Pallikunhi
b530fb9d07 ARM: dts: qcom: enable userspace cooling device for display fps
Enable userspace cooling device for display fps mitigation.
It enables to monitor any thermal zone sensor and trigger display
fps mitigation.

Change-Id: Ic2a0d0a2be462d9ed2032c8dbc49208d6c431a08
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-08 14:02:21 +05:30
Manaf Meethalavalappu Pallikunhi
1440afa5c8 ARM: dts: qcom: enable NSP qmi cooling devices
Enable different NSP qmi thermal mitigation devices for sun.
It enables to mitigate these devices during different thermal
and limits violation.

Change-Id: I8bad9da560df7033473c614af324f79c66cb7dac
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-08 14:02:17 +05:30
Manaf Meethalavalappu Pallikunhi
1bc0ca5aa8 ARM: dts: qcom: update thermal cpu pause and hotplug cooling devices
Update thermal pause and cpu hotplug cooling devices to support
partial good cpus.

Also remove duplicate group pause cooling devices.

Change-Id: Idb6c72f42a89d4d643a5c658d24e1045d3ef8b80
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-08 14:02:08 +05:30
Manaf Meethalavalappu Pallikunhi
8c60809c4f ARM: dts: qcom: Clean up modem TS and TMDs for sun
Remove unused modem thermal sensors and thermal mitigation devices
which are no longer needed for sun as per recommendation.

Also add sub1 related thermal mitigation devices.

Change-Id: Iacb2d66f7a65e52559211aa4710eba4cae67831e
Signed-off-by: Rashid Zafar <quic_rzafar@quicinc.com>
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-08 14:01:58 +05:30
Manaf Meethalavalappu Pallikunhi
c7e571971c ARM: dts: qcom: Enable DDR cooling device for sun
Enable DDR cooling device for sun which allows it to vote for
specific DDR bandwidth under thermal conditions.

Change-Id: I55b8c61d4cf580392cf76ae1ed6328b69cca6487
Signed-off-by: Rashid Zafar <quic_rzafar@quicinc.com>
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-08 14:01:38 +05:30
Manaf Meethalavalappu Pallikunhi
328e0855c3 ARM: dts: qcom: Enable userspace CPU freq cooling device for sun
Enable userspace CPU frequency cooling device for sun. This config
will enable cluster0 and cluster1 to be registered as cooling devices.

Change-Id: I4a88c5f03b9da0e4ef1406e7e973d148c074dd93
Signed-off-by: Rashid Zafar <quic_rzafar@quicinc.com>
Signed-off-by: Manaf Meethalavalappu Pallikunhi <quic_manafm@quicinc.com>
2024-01-08 14:01:13 +05:30
Lei Chen
d6b20231e1 ARM: dts: msm: add proxy properties to DSI supplies for sun target
Add proxy enable properties to the DSI core and panel supplies
to support continuous splash.

Change-Id: Ib8d0ae5340eee86b29b57284226a59d3152bfab7
Signed-off-by: Lei Chen <quic_chenlei@quicinc.com>
2024-01-07 17:21:33 -08:00
David Collins
a681eb00ba ARM: dts: qcom: keep L2F and L3F regulators always-on for Sun boards
Configure the L2F and L3F regulators on Sun boards to be always
enabled.  This ensures that WCN hardware operates correctly.
Use low power mode (LPM) as the initial mode to reduce current
consumption before BT or WLAN is enabled.

Change-Id: I7820a19dd89fda0abfe6094420a8d72c8acbe33a
Signed-off-by: David Collins <quic_collinsd@quicinc.com>
2024-01-05 20:19:08 -08:00
qctecmdr
4f98b462d8 Merge "ARM: dts: msm: Add PMIC ADC5 GEN4 channels for sun" 2024-01-05 18:00:25 -08:00
Unnathi Chalicheemala
44378f46da ARM: dts: msm: Add LLCC broadacst register mappings
Add mappings for LLCC Broadcast_OR, Broadcast_AND regions.

Change-Id: I1f6e55ec2acb6857c8473849847bd3b10e5d7697
Signed-off-by: Unnathi Chalicheemala <quic_uchalich@quicinc.com>
2024-01-05 10:21:22 -08:00
Yuanfang Zhang
0e1b3b9b18 ARM: dts: msm: add gpu funnel for sun
Add gpu funnel to support CX DBGC and GX DBGC trace.

Change-Id: I8658a657aa83d1338329dda3108d982e591e6a92
Signed-off-by: Yuanfang Zhang <quic_yuanfang@quicinc.com>
2024-01-05 00:15:58 -08:00
Yuanfang Zhang
1b7411497c ARM: dts: msm: add cluster cache dump entry on sun
Add cluster cache memory dump entry for sun.

Change-Id: I5dfcaa4e34e961a8eceef1ccf4b7a1d300f2bb47
Signed-off-by: Yuanfang Zhang <quic_yuanfang@quicinc.com>
2024-01-05 00:10:36 -08:00